2020 Jeep Grand Cherokee SRT
By JGGCSRT | on 5/3/2026 6:21:32 PM
I normally wait until I accumulate miles on a vehicle before I make reviews and this one is no exception. I've had this Jeep for 6 years and put 90k miles on it so far and all I can say is I'm very happy with it, NO ISSUES, and stuck to all the maintenance recommendations. Although it's an SRT, the Jeep is a VERY GOOD INTERSTATE/ROAD TRIP vehicle. The Adaptive suspension keeps things smooth despite its firmness. You can tell it's the sport variant but it's still comfortable. You still get your creature comforts, heated/cooled front and heated rear seats/adaptive cruise, 19 speaker Harman/Kardon sounds amazing, the Pano sunroof is a great bonus. It's also a work horse as I use it to tow various things. The largest thing I towed was a pick up truck on the back using a car hauler and it handled it really well. The seats are a bit firm as well but they are sport seats. This is a vehicle that I'm going to keep.…
